Columbus, Ohio-based travel writer Rich Warren for 30 years has traveled the country and the world looking for offbeat and off-the-beaten-path stories. He is a graduate of the Elf School of Reykjavik and can tell you what the Amish wear to the beach in Florida! A graduate of Kent State University, Rich served for 16 years as editor of the Ohio-based publication Country Living. He is the recipient of the Mark Twain Travel Writer of the Year by the Midwest Travel Journalists Association. Credits include the Chicago Tribune, Dallas Morning News, Cleveland Plain Dealer, National Geographic Traveler, AAA World, AAA Home and Away, Ohio Magazine, Long Weekends, American Way, AARP online, Virtuoso Living online, TripSavvy.com and others.
